Back in 2005, at the age of 42, I was diagnosed with Major Clinical Depression after the passing of my father and 2 close friends within a period of few months. I was devastated, feeling lost, hopeless and helpless.

The actual depressive episode was not a shock to me, what threw me out of base was the realization that I had been depressed since I was a child. So I knew I needed help desperately.

Since I had been depressed my entire life, I needed to know how not to be depressed. It was so ingrained in my psyche that I couldn’t fathom the thought of not being depressed.

I started asking myself: what does it feel not being depressed?. It was like having to learn to walk or speak all over again.

Did I know what to do?. No at all, but when my doctor’s help and lots of soul searching the answers started to come up

When a person is depressed the last thing she thinks is, am I depressed?. Sad feelings and emotions make it very difficult to seek for help because your logical mind gets clouded and a lot of times it takes family and/or friends to pull you out and take you to the doctor.

What threw me out of base was when the doctor told me that I had been depressed pretty much for my entire life, based on my clinical history.

After I while I realize that I could not remember the last time I was ever happy.

You know what Dr. Phil says: “you can’t change what you don’t acknowledge”. Getting diagnosed was the first step towards a better and fuller life.
